Patent number: 11270178Abstract: Briefly, an intelligent label is associated with a good, and includes one or more permanent and irreversible electrochromic indicators that are used to report the condition of that good at selected points in the movement or usage of that good. These electrochromic indicators provide immediate visual information regarding the status of the good without need to interrogate or communicate with the electronics or processor on the intelligent label. In this way, anyone in the shipping or use chain for the good, including the end user consumer, can quickly understand whether the product is meeting shipping and quality standards. If a product fails to meet shipping or quality standards, the particular point where the product failed can be quickly and easily identified, and information can be used to assure the consumer remains safe, while providing essential information for improving the shipping process.Type: GrantFiled: January 26, 2018Date of Patent: March 8, 2022Inventors: Paul Atkinson, James Kruest, Anoop Agrawal, John P Cronin, Lori L Adams, Juan Carlos L Tonazzi

Publication number: 20080090527Abstract: A radio frequency controller device is provided that enables the utility of an integrated circuit (IC) device using an RF communication. The radio frequency controller device has a switch that is set to a defined state responsive to the RF communication. More particularly, conditional logic circuitry uses the RF communication to determine if the IC's utility should be changed, and sets the state of the switch accordingly. The radio frequency controller device also has an IC interface that allows the IC to determine the state of the switch, and based on the state of the switch, a different utility will be available for the integrated circuit device. The radio frequency controller device also has an antenna for the RF communication, as well as a demodulator/modulator circuit.Type: ApplicationFiled: May 25, 2007Publication date: April 17, 2008Inventors: Paul Atkinson, James Kruest, Ronald Conero, Rakesh Kumar, Kendall Reyzer

Publication number: 20080024273Abstract: RFID tags are used for many purpose including tracking. RFID interrogators are used to retrieve information from tags. In many applications, RFID interrogators and RFID tags remain stationary during interrogation. Regions of low energy due to interference from either additional antenna or reflections from RFID tags and objects can impede or prohibit the reading of RFID tags residing in such regions. Stirring of the generated electromagnetic field is a method of moving around the regions of low energy, where tags can not be read, during the interrogation process. Mechanical stirring is accomplished by introducing a conductor into the electromagnetic field and moving it about in the field. Solid state stirring is accomplished by introducing a variable conductor into the field and varying the conductivity of the variable conductor. Mathematical stirring is accomplished by use of a plurality of antenna and controlling the phase difference between the antenna in a configuration known as phased antenna arrays.Type: ApplicationFiled: June 21, 2007Publication date: January 31, 2008Applicant: NEOLOGY, INC.Inventors: James Kruest, Gary Bann

Publication number: 20080018489Abstract: RFID tags are used for many purpose including tracking. RFID interrogators are used to retrieve information from tags. In many applications, a plurality of RFID interrogators are required. Synchronization between interrogators in the same theatre of operation is critical to ensure that their broadcasts do not interfere with each other. In fixed RFID interrogator applications, RFID interrogators can be wired together allowing a channel to synchronize the transmissions of the RFID interrogators. Methods described herein can ensure that synchronization is maintained in the event of the failure of a synchronizing master. Furthermore, additional methods for synchronizing RFID interrogators in wireless applications are described allowing synchronization in the absence of wired connections between interrogators.Type: ApplicationFiled: June 21, 2007Publication date: January 24, 2008Applicant: NEOLOGY, INC.Inventors: James Kruest, Gary Bann
